Which of the following is a characteristic of monocotyledons?
Correct Answer: Parallel leaf venation and one seed leaf
- Step 1: Understand what monocotyledons (monocots) are. They are a group of flowering plants.
- Step 2: Identify the main characteristics of monocots.
- Step 3: Note that monocots have one seed leaf, which is called a cotyledon.
- Step 4: Observe that the leaves of monocots usually have parallel veins, meaning the lines in the leaves run parallel to each other.
- Step 5: Conclude that the characteristic of having parallel leaf venation and one seed leaf is typical for monocots.
